Action item from the Lanternbox outage review: begin splitting the user module out of the monolith. First step is routing reads through the new facade with a shadow-write comparison. Rollout is percentage-gated and reversible within one deploy. Owner is the platform pod; target is two sprints. The rollout gate values we agreed on are listed below.

tuning table, hafog-bahaf:
QUOTAS = {
    "praion": 144,
    "briax": 906,
    "silwyn": 451,
}

**Action Item PM-14: Localize date formats in Tarnwell exports**

The incident stemmed from ambiguous day/month ordering in exported audit logs, which delayed the security team's timeline reconstruction by several hours. We will enforce ISO 8601 in all machine-readable outputs and locale-aware rendering only at display time. The proposed format policy and rollout plan are documented on the internal standards page.

wiki page, tahaf-tajog: https://jira.ordindyn.corp/pipeline

## Artifact Signing for Cachewright Plugins

Plugins that hook the Cachewright catalog invalidation pipeline must ship signed artifacts; unsigned bundles are ignored at load time. Build your bundle, compute the manifest digest, and attach a detached signature before uploading to the plugin channel. All external authors currently sign against the shared channel key, reproduced here:

rollout seal: bky4_x7Gc

Handover — cron drift on Saltgrove schedulers

Short version: jobs on the Saltgrove batch tier drift forward roughly 40s per day. I ruled out NTP; clocks are fine. The drift correlates with the queue-depth backoff in the Pellwick dispatcher, which delays re-arming the timer. Logs from last Tuesday show it clearly. Next step: reproduce with backoff disabled in staging, then compare. Everything you need is in the tracker under the drift epic. The dispatcher currently runs with the settings below.

settings of tagef-bawif:
DRUIX_HOST=druix.zemvarlabs.internal
DRUIX_PORT=8000

- [ ] **Step 7: Breaker override escrow.** After sealing the signing keys for the Tallgrove upstream API circuit breaker, confirm the support team can force the breaker open during a full outage. The override bundle lives in the sealed escrow drawer and is useless without its unlock phrase. Two ceremony witnesses must initial this step before proceeding. The escrow bundle is decrypted with the recovery passphrase that follows.

vault phrase of kahip-kahop = holath-quenmir